Water Features
Water resources on El Regalo Ranch provide both immediate functionality and future enhancement potential. The ranch currently features five surface tanks positioned throughout the property, supporting wildlife movement and habitat diversity across the ranch when full.
These tanks respond well to seasonal rainfall and offer meaningful upside for future improvements or expansion through continued management practices.
In addition, the ranch is serviced by Three Rivers city water and a newly established holding tank located beneath the carport, providing reliable water infrastructure for residential and operational use — a valuable asset for a ranch of this scale and location.
Wildlife
El Regalo Ranch is built around an established and carefully managed wildlife program designed to preserve and enhance strong native South Texas whitetail genetics. Through years of intentional feeding practices, protein supplementation, selective harvest, and habitat management, the ranch has developed into a highly functional turnkey hunting operation with a proven deer program already in place and no introduced genetics.
As of November 2025, the ranch supports approximately 50 native-genetics whitetail bucks along with more than 70 does, creating an impressive foundation for continued trophy deer management. The established feeding program and nutrition infrastructure have played a major role in supporting herd health, antler growth, and overall wildlife quality throughout the ranch.
The ranch is enrolled in MLD Level III and includes a soft release/DMP pen system with water already piped in place, allowing the next owner to immediately continue or expand wildlife management goals with ease.
Axis deer and oryx add year-round hunting opportunities and additional recreational diversity, while native South Texas species including turkey, duck, quail, dove, and javelina are commonly found throughout the ranch.
